Queen Mary University of London stops several online courses

  1. Queen Mary University of London has stopped accepting new students for its Queen Mary Online (QMO) courses.
  2. This decision follows the end of its partnership with CEG Digital.
  3. Current QMO students are expected to complete their courses by January 2027.
  4. QMO courses were popular among international students for their cost-effectiveness and flexibility.
  5. Course fees were fixed, with no difference between UK and international students.
  6. Despite ending the CEG Digital partnership, Queen Mary remains committed to online education.
  7. The university offers over 50 other online degree programs that will continue.
  8. Queen Mary's Vision 2030 strategy includes expanding online learning opportunities.
  9. CEG Digital will support Queen Mary in exploring new online education possibilities.
  10. Some students, particularly those who appreciated the program's benefits, view the end of QMO courses as a loss.
